I was initially maddened at the scene as I have described above not because I was rooting for Madeline but I really hoped that her end would be to face the law for her crimes and be put away.. this is until it was revealed that Alison set the whole thing up.

One thing this show succeeded in really doing well is to show the unfolding of the SBK curse from the moment Madeline decided to get rid of his body without involving the cops. It is like a seed that was planted which grew to destroy everything in their family.

It's funny how Alison swore that she was not the same as her mum at that scene where they have a quarrel but she turns around to do EXACTLY what her mum would have done in her shoes.. The interview scene with her seemingly praising herself for the way she handled the whole thing is off-putting.. it was as if Madeline was being interviewed..

Madeline may be dead but the curse remains..
